In this review of Strategic Sport Development, the bottom line is clear: this book is for students and practitioners who need a practical bridge between business strategy and sports delivery. Stephen Robson presents the subject in a way that makes the material usable for those working in local clubs, national bodies or private sports institutions, and the single biggest reason to buy is the book's focus on applying strategic management techniques directly to sports development practice. The review finds the text thorough and pragmatic, with case studies that anchor abstract ideas in real-world settings.

Key Features

  • Comprehensive strategic framework: Explains core strategic concepts so readers can design coherent development plans for sport programmes and organisations.
  • Case study focus: Uses national and local case studies to show how strategic management practice plays out in real sports development environments.
  • Accessible introductions: Provides separate full introductions to sports development and strategy, helping readers new to either field get up to speed quickly.
  • Practical application: Emphasises techniques and tools that practitioners can adapt to planning, delivery and evaluation tasks in clubs and institutions.
  • International relevance: Although framed in a UK context, the strategic principles are applicable to sports organisations internationally.

Who It's For

Strategic Sport Development is aimed primarily at postgraduate and advanced undergraduate sports students, sports development officers, and managers in national and local sports organisations who need to apply strategic management to programme planning and delivery. It suits readers who require both conceptual grounding and practical examples to inform decision making.

Those seeking highly technical coaching manuals, specialist performance training guides or step-by-step grassroots coaching drills should look elsewhere, as the book concentrates on planning, policy and organisational strategy rather than on individual coaching techniques or sports science protocols.
